PolicyPress, our compliance policy toolchain, is now available on the GitHub Marketplace. Write your security policies in Markdown, keep them in your own Git repository, and a single GitHub Action publishes a branded policy site and versioned, audit-ready PDFs on every push.

Who it’s for

If your organization’s policies live in a Word document someone emailed around - nobody sure which version is current, who approved it, or when it was last reviewed - PolicyPress is for you. It sits deliberately between the two usual answers: GRC suites priced for enterprises, and wikis that can’t produce the versioned, signed-off PDF trail an auditor or customer actually asks for.

You do not need to know anything about web development, LaTeX, or compliance frameworks. If you can click a button on GitHub and edit a text file, you can have a professional policy library in an afternoon - and because PolicyPress is the toolchain, not the content, your policies never leave your infrastructure.

What you get

  • A policy website your employees can bookmark, branded with your logo and colors, with a dashboard homepage computed from the policies themselves
  • A versioned PDF for every policy, named by title and version, plus full revision history - who approved what, and when
  • Draft watermarks and redaction - policies under review are clearly marked, and internal notes are stripped from published PDFs
  • Compliance mapping - tag policies with Secure Controls Framework and SOC 2 control IDs and get coverage reports as versioned PDFs
  • Opt-in extras for procurement and audit: tagged accessible PDFs (PDF/UA-1), a machine-readable audit bundle with SHA-256 hashes of every artifact, and private-by-default publishing with a turnkey SSO configuration

Free for your own organization

PolicyPress is free to run for your own organization at any size - nonprofit, school, government body, or for-profit company - under the PolyForm Noncommercial and Internal Use licenses. Payment enters only when you want SC2 to stand behind it (a support subscription) or when you use PolicyPress to serve third parties, such as an MSP running it for clients or a hosted offering.
